English for Speakers of Other Languages


ESOL Skills For Life courses are designed for nonnative speakers of english to improve their language skills in order to cope with everyday life in the UK.

You’ll study speaking and listening, reading and writing to improve your skills in listening and responding, speaking to communicate, contributing effectively, and engaging in discussions and improving your spelling, grammar and punctuation skills.

We offer both full and flexible part-time courses and our highly experienced team will discuss the best options for you. Full-time courses are for 16–18 year olds, with the opportunity to go on trips and undertake work experience. The part-time provision is for adults, with a variety of classes running in the mornings, afternoon and evenings.

Progression opportunities are available on to our GCSE programmes, these include biology, English, maths further boosting your skills and employment opportunities.

Many of our students progress into vocational subject areas on completion of the ESOL programme.
